Maniac Mansion: Day of the Tentacle screenshot
Maniac Mansion: Day of the Tentacle is an adventure-puzzle game developed by LucasArts Entertainment. It came out on 25-06-1993. It was published by LucasArts Entertainment. On review aggregator Metacritic, Maniac Mansion: Day of the Tentacle has a score of 93. The game is rated as "Exceptional" on RAWG. You can play Maniac Mansion: Day of the Tentacle on PC and macOS. Dave Grossman and Tim Schafer produced the game. It was directed by Dave Grossman and Tim Schafer. It was scored by Clint Bajakian, Michael Land and Peter McConnell.
